I have confidence in my reloads much more than ANY other cartridges from Any person. I have loaded conveniently in excess of two hundred,000 rounds of ammo for all sorts of pistols and rifles. If you can Reduce the cost of the ammo in half or considerably less, reloading would make a lot of sense. As an example I have a .38 Webey MK IV revolver that shoots a 38 S&W cartridge. If you could find new within the box ammo for this it usually goes for over $35 a box of fifty cartridges. Soon after the expense of the brass, the price of reloading this cartridge is below $two.50 for 50 cartridges and lower than a one/two hrs of work(start to finish, it requires me about 45 min to load a hundred cartridges.) This is a major cost savings and permits you to shoot a gun that requires a exceptional cartridge. Guaranteed, I've built some faults, didn't put ability in the case, in excess of billed the case, etcetera. but I've built in some safeguards like inspecting Each and every case just after I've charged it but right before I seat the bullet, using a hand priming tool, that enables me to deal with and inspect Each and every situation once the depriming/resizing stage, selecting a measure of powder that could overflow the situation if double charged, weighing Just about every powder demand just before I begin the reloading session even when I'm loading exactly the same set up and cartridge as previous time.
Effectively, it is dependent upon the caliber that you are reloading. For anyone who is reloading large caliber or unconventional rifle cartridges, you can save an important amount of cash. When you are reloading prevalent handgun ammo, like 9mm, you'll only conserve reload ammo all over ten-20% and you continue to have to Think about your time and energy.
